[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]You can also use a pressure cooker - takes about 15 minutes max. I do soak the bean (any kind - black, pinto, kidney, small red, garbanzo) overnight and then put them in the pressure cooker for about 6 whistles. [/quote] these things terrify me -- they seem dangerous![/quote] +1 for pressure cooker. In India, where I'm from, no household is without one. Makes cooking rice, beans etc a snap. They are not dangerous, but yes, can cause harm if not used properly. It isn't rocket science though. You have to make sure the seal is tight, and that there's enough water in the bottom to create steam. And never open until safe to do so - different models have different indicators that the pressure inside is down to normal.[/quote] Another Indian here. Pressure cooker is the way to go.
